Ililoa Ahupuaa, District of Puna, Island of Hawaii, Boundary Commission, Hawaii, Volume B, pps 413-414

The Ahupuaa of Ililoa, District of Puna, Hawaii

For Petition see Folio 220, Book A.

On this, the 29th day of February A.D. 1876, the Commission of Land Boundaries for the Island of Hawaii, 3d Judicial Circuit met at the Court House in Hilo, Hawaii, on the application of His Majesty, D. Kalakaua, for the settlement of the boundaries of the Ahupuaa of Ililoa, situated in the District of Puna, Island of Hawaii, 3d Judicial Circuit.

Notice of time and place of hearing personally served on interested parties, as far as known.

Present: L. Kaina on the part of applicant, and the Hawaiian Government.

Testimony
Rev. Makuakane, kane, sworn, says I know land of Ililoa. It is a small land between Kauaea and Opihikao in Puna. I know its boundaries. The boundary at the shore on the Hilo side between this land and Kauaea is at the Ahupuaa (ahupohaku) where they used to set up the idol; it is on a point. Thence the boundary runs up mauka along old iwi aina to place called Ahuamalama, at the mauka end of the land, where the iwi aina between this land, and Kauaea turns towards Kau, and cuts this land off to junction with land of Opihikao.

Thence the boundary between Ililoa and Opihikao runs makai along old iwi aina to a sea shore to a point in sea called Hoea. It is bounded on the makai side by the sea, and had ancient fishing rights extending out to sea. The land of Kauaea has been surveyed. Part of Opihikao has been surveyed and patented to myself.
Cross-examined.

Kahula, kane, sworn, says, I was born at Kauaea, Puna, Hawaii. I have heard that it was at the time of Houlu ako ana o Hailihope ma Hilo. I know the land of Ililoa.

I and my father had charge of it for 20 years for Kamehameha I. The boundary at the shore between this land and Kauaea is at an ahupuaa or ahupohaku at a point on the shore; Thence the boundary between these lands runs mauka along old iwi aina, an iwi pohaku to mauka side of Ahuamalama; thence the iwi turns across the head of the land to boundary of Opihikao. Thence the boundary of this land runs makai along iwi aina of Opihikao to point at sea shore called Koea. Bounded makai by the sea, and has ancient fishing rights extending out to sea.
Cross-examined.

The survey made by Leve (D.B. Lyman) of boundary adjoining Kauaea is correct.

Testimony closed

Decision
The boundaries of Ililoa in Puna, are decided to be as given in notes of survey filed by F.S. Lyman, Certificate of Boundaries to be issued as of today.

For Certificate of Boundaries see Folio 192, Liber I., No. 88.
R.A. Lyman, Commissioner of Land Boundaries, 3d Judicial Circuit
